A series of education podcasts for core medical trainees and medical students covering the whole curriculum for the MRCP exam.

Episode 85: Ep 79 - Jaundice 24.09.2021

Dr Andrew Baxter, a Consultant Gastroenterologist at Nottingham University Hospitals, explains the process of investigating a patient with jaundice - from bloods and imaging to endoscopic investigations.

Episode 82: Ep 76 - Hyperosmolar Hyperglycaemic State (HHS) 03.09.2021

We are joined this week by Dr Tom Crabtree, a diabetes registrar from Derby Royal Hospital. We will cover the pathophysiology and typical presenting complaint of HHS, a little about the definition and importantly, key things to remember when managing these patients.

Episode 73: Ep 67 - PACES: Medical Error 02.07.2021

A case of medical error can be used in the ethics and communication station in PACES. In this episode, we welcome Dr Hannah Tobiss, a patient safety fellow at Nottingham Hospitals. She explains the duty of candour and how to communicate a medical error to patients and families.
